Paris, 1950s. In this graphic novel adaptation, Nestor Burma’s past comes knocking when Bélita, a young woman, leads him to the Salpêtrière hospital, where he discovers the recently deceased Abel Benoît, an old buddy from his anarchist days. While Burma has chosen to move onto the (more or less) straight and narrow as a private eye, his friend had stayed on the other side of the law as a counterfeiter and worse, until his own past caught up with him — lethally. So now it’s up to Malet to avenge his friend, and hopefully unravel a mystery whose roots run far and deep back into the past...

Jacques Tardi is a pioneering European cartoonist. His Adele Blanc-Sec (Casterman) series was adapted into a feature by Luc Besson, and he was behind the recent animated film April and the Extraordinary World (StudioCanal, 2015). His comics are award winning (including the U.S.'s Eisners). He lives in Paris with his wife, the singer Dominique Grange, and their cats. Léo Malet (1909-1996) was a prolific and revered French crime novelist and surrealist.
Fog Over Tolbiac Bridge is the first of four major graphic novels adapted by Tardi from the legendary French crime writer Léo Malet's original 'Nestor Burma' novels. Tardi's stylish use of mechanical gray tones provides the book with a lovely period feel which, combined with Tardi's usual obsessive visual research, gives it a uniquely personal, authentic quality. Tardi's adaptation is a cracking good detective yarn and a milestone in comics history.
